There are two main steps to paying off student loans. First, be sure to pay the monthly amount due on each loan you have taken out. Second, make extra payments on the loan whose interest rate is highest, not the loan that has the largest balance. This will cut back on the amount of total interest you wind up paying.

It is important to know how much time after graduation you have before your first loan payment is due. Stafford loans provide a six month grace period. For a Perkins loan, this period is 9 months. Other types can vary. It is important to know the time limits to avoid being late.

Think about what payment option works for you. Lots of student loans offer ten-year repayment plans. If this does not fit your needs, you may be able to find other options. Understand if you choose a longer repayment period you will end up having to pay more in interest. You might even only have to pay a certain percentage of what you earn once you finally do start making money. Some student loan balances are forgiven after twenty five years has passed.

Going into default on your loans is not a wise idea. The federal government has multiple options available to recover its money. They can take your income taxes or Social Security. They can also claim up to fifteen percent of your income that is disposable. Most of the time, not paying your student loans will cost you more than just making the payments.
